Prompted by fuzz's posts about his hacking website, here's some info on how you can get some privacy by encrypting your emails.
First off, if you've not already dropped Outlook Express do it now. You use FireFox rather than IE, so why not use Thinderbird rather than OE?
So, download and install Thinderbird.
Next you'll need to install EnigMail. This is an extension for Thunderbird which allows you to encrypt/decrypt messages, digitally sign emails that you send so that people can verify they're from you and unmodified, and it also includes a key manager.
To install it, download THIS FILE. Then in Thunderbird, click the Tools --> Extensions --> Install. Then select the file you downloaded.
Once you've got everything installed, you need to generate your keypair. You give the public key out to everybody, and you keep the private key to yourself.
Best thing to do is upload the public key to a keyserver, so that people who want to send you secure emails can find your key.
These two keyservers are good:
https://pgp.mit.edu/
https://www.keyserver.net/
They will also send your key on to other keyservers round the internet.
Now you're all set!
You can sign emails with your private key, and people can verify that they're genuine using your public key. You can also decrypt emails people have sent to you with your private key if they've encrypted them using your public key.
